Red African rooibos tea (rooibos, rooibos) is gradually conquering the world market and this is due not only to its taste, but also to a lot of useful properties. In 1995, South African research company Infruitec, as well as Professor Charlene Marayi of Independent State University, discovered and confirmed that rooibos is: anti-allergen; antispasmodic; possesses antibacterial properties; slows down the aging process; has an antiviral effect; antioxidant; caffeine free; has a low tannin content. The presence of antioxidants found in 1980 by Japanese and American scientists is greater in rooibos than in green tea, especially the presence of a powerful stable antioxidant superoxide dismutase (SOD). Super-oxide dismutase extremely effectively neutralizes free radicals. Free radicals are substances that lack one electron, and therefore they strive to oxidize everything, that is, to take away the missing electron from one of the molecules in the cells of the body. When this happens, the intracellular balance is disturbed, an instant chain reaction occurs, billions of new health destroyers penetrate the weakened cell. Countless free radicals are just waiting in the wings to rush to storm the human body. Free radicals are the cause of aging and many heart diseases. Thanks to this substance, rooibos is useful in the treatment of high blood pressure, diabetes, atherosclerosis, allergic epidemics, liver diseases and cataracts. The antispasmodic properties of rooibos can relieve colic and stomach cramps, as well as help with skin diseases such as eczema and rashes. Unlike many other drinks, rooibos has a very low content of oxalic acid, which prevents kidney stones from appearing. Intensive studies of the beneficial qualities of rooibos tea conducted in Japan additionally revealed yet another unique properties of tea: • providing a general calming effect on the central nervous system, reducing excessive irritability and irritability, lowering blood pressure; • assistance in violation of sleep patterns and insomnia; • reduction of skin itching, help with allergies, hay fever, asthma, eczema; • restoration and normalization of the stomach during digestive disorders, nausea, vomiting and heartburn; • beneficial effect on the skin and bone tissue. Most likely, such properties are due to the interaction of a large number of substances found in rooibos red tea. After studying the composition of rooibos, scientists identified 8 phenol carboxylic acids, some of which are of great antibacterial importance. Rooibos also contains 9 flavonoids, which, in combination with vitamin C, help to neutralize free radicals that cause age-related changes. And the content of oxalic acid in the drink was very low, which prevents the appearance of kidney stones. It was found that three cups of rooibos cover one third of a person's daily iron requirements. Moreover, the content of vitamin C, copper in tea, as well as the low content of tannin allow the body to better absorb iron and promote blood formation. Therefore, Roibos is especially recommended for pregnant and lactating women, as well as athletes.
